If the board is convinced that the first BS2 course was failed deliberately, then Article 4.8 paragraph a) of the internal regulations is deemed to apply. If the board does not come to that conviction, the course must be retaken on the earliest possible occasion. In case of willful failure to pass the referee course, a fine of 50 euros will be imposed.

- Fines attributed for playing without a game rule certificate will solely impact the player in question. Starting from the 2022-2023 season, it is required that players up to the age of 24 are in possession of a game rule certificate.
